Ewbank’s in Woking, Surrey, has hired James Hammond as its Asian art specialist and valuer. Hammond began his career as a porter at Christie’s in 1979, and lived in Tokyo, working with a Japanese auction house, before returning to the UK and joining Bonhams in Knightsbridge as head of the Asian art department. He worked for Bonhams in London, Tokyo and Singapore. Highlights from his career include the sale of the early Ming, blue and white, Xuande brushwasher from the Edward T Chow Collection in 1992.

Guernsey’s Martel Maides auction house has hired art specialist and valuer Jonathan Voak to represent the firm in Jersey.

Voak was previously at the Victoria and Albert Museum where he was a curator before joining its subsidiary Apsley House, The Wellington Museum on London’s Hyde Park Corner as manager. From 1997 he has run his firm Atelier in Jersey with his wife Colette, dealing in oil paintings from the 17th to early 20th century as well as watercolours, drawings and etchings. In 2005 he became a member of the British Antique Dealers’ Association (BADA).

James Bridges, managing director of Martel Maides, said: “We have been helping Jersey clients for several years, but with Jonathan’s appointment we will be able to significantly grow this relationship.”

The Channel Islands firm was established in 1976.

Jonny Fowle has joined Sotheby’s as its first-ever spirits specialist. He has worked in the whisky trade for a number of years in roles including a whisky trainer for hotel companies, an ambassador for whisky brands and a whisky broker.

Jamie Ritchie, worldwide head of Sotheby’s Wine, said: “Historically, spirits were integrated into our wine auctions and constituted a small part of our business. Over recent years, we have seen increasing sales of both Scotch and Japanese whiskies, as well as Moutai [a Chinese spirit], which now represents about 5% of our business. Jonny will focus on developing spirits as a separate category and growing this area of the business through single-owner live auctions, online auctions and direct sales of high-value bottles and casks.”

In 2018, Sotheby’s reported sales of wine and spirits had exceeded $100m for the first time.

Heritage Auctions has hired music-industry veteran and journalist Pete Howard. He will join its entertainment team as entertainment and music consignment director specialising in concert posters.
